Effect of concavity and slots on rectangular patch antennas

Abstract

In this work, the use of concave rectangular patches is proposed in the aim of reducing mutual coupling without increasing the occupation surface of antennas. The introduction of the curvatures in the radiating edges and slots in the non-radiating edges has suppressed the mutual coupling between the elements of the structure containing a pilot with a parasitic. This technique is applied with separation between elements very small as compared to the operating wavelength and the global dimensions of the patches comparable to those without modifications operating at the same frequency. Furthermore, the proposed method does not affect the radiation patterns except some deviation of the maximum radiation direction from the broadside.
